B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, precisely formulated for feed-grade use and tested to fulfill stringent high-quality and protection standards. BHT is a lipophilic organic compound that is generally made use of being an antioxidant in different industrial applications. In animal nourishment, BHT FEED GRADE TEST is commonly utilised to avoid the oxidation of fats and oils in animal feed, thereby preserving the nutritional benefit and extending the shelf lifetime of the feed. Oxidized fats not merely drop nutritional efficacy but can also deliver hazardous compounds, affecting the health and expansion of livestock. The inclusion of BHT in feed needs arduous screening to ensure it adheres to regulatory criteria and it is safe for usage by animals, which eventually enters the human food items chain. The testing protocols generally evaluate the purity, efficacy, and possible residues in animal tissues.

A different crucial compound while in the chemical area is Pentachloropyridine. This compound is actually a chlorinated spinoff of pyridine and it has garnered interest resulting from its utility being an intermediate in the synthesis of agrochemicals, dyes, and prescribed drugs. Its significant diploma of chlorination makes it a potent compound, which should be taken care of with treatment because of likely toxicity and environmental fears. Pentachloropyridine serves as a creating block in chemical synthesis, letting chemists to develop much more sophisticated molecules Which may be Utilized in herbicides, insecticides, as well as specialty polymers. The managing and disposal of Pentachloropyridine are controlled, supplied its probable environmental persistence and bioaccumulation hazard. Industries dealing with this compound normally undertake shut-technique generation approaches and demanding security protocols to minimize publicity.

M-Phenylene Diamine, usually abbreviated as MPD, can be an aromatic amine that features prominently during the manufacture of aramid fibers, that happen to be properly-known for their warmth resistance and energy. Kevlar and Nomex, used in body armor and fireplace-resistant apparel, respectively, are made utilizing MPD as a vital precursor. The compound itself is made of a benzene ring with two amino groups in the meta positions, which makes it ideal for creating polymers with fascinating thermal and mechanical Qualities. M-Phenylene Diamine (MPD) is usually Utilized in the dye marketplace, notably in hair dyes and also other beauty programs, although its use has actually been curtailed in some areas due to security fears. When manufacturing products and solutions made up of MPD, correct occupational basic safety practices are necessary to guard workers from prolonged exposure, which may lead to pores and skin sensitization or other health concerns.

O-Phenylene Diamine (OPDA), whilst structurally just like MPD, differs from the positioning from the amino groups, which substantially influences its chemical reactivity and software. OPDA is frequently used in the production of dyes and pigments, in which it contributes to your development of vivid hues that are stable and lengthy-lasting. It's also used in the synthesis of heterocyclic compounds and pharmaceuticals. OPDA’s function in corrosion inhibitors and rubber chemical substances more highlights its versatility. Nonetheless, much like other aromatic amines, OPDA is additionally linked to toxicity pitfalls, and therefore, its use is very carefully controlled and monitored. The importance of correct managing, ideal storage, and satisfactory protective steps can't be overstated when managing OPDA in almost any industrial placing.

Pinacolone is another noteworthy compound with a number of purposes. It is just a ketone Together with the molecular formulation C6H12O and is made use of largely as an intermediate during the synthesis of pesticides and herbicides, notably inside the creation of triazole fungicides and specified plant growth regulators. Pinacolone’s construction features a tertiary butyl group, which contributes to its one of a kind reactivity in natural synthesis. Beyond agriculture, it can be located in the manufacture of prescribed drugs Pentachloropyridine and fragrances. Pinacolone is valued for its power to endure nucleophilic substitution and condensation reactions, which makes it a valuable reagent in laboratory and industrial processes. Though it really is fewer hazardous than many of the previously talked about compounds, basic safety safety measures are still required to mitigate any challenges related to its volatility and possible irritant Homes.

two-Heptanone is a ketone that By natural means happens in a few crops and is additionally found in tiny quantities in human sweat and specific animal secretions. It is often Utilized in the fragrance and flavor industries resulting from its nice, fruity odor. Also, two-Heptanone has observed apps to be a solvent and intermediate in natural and organic synthesis. Apparently, exploration has prompt that it may well Participate in a job in chemical signaling, specially in insects, where by it functions as an alarm pheromone. This has led to its study in pest control strategies and behavioral science. Industrially, two-Heptanone is synthesized for use in coatings, adhesives, and cleaners. Its comparatively reduced toxicity can make it appropriate for use in buyer items, Even though appropriate labeling and managing Guidelines are usually mandated.
